Output efa3181a94ed4421dea3e46cabd4e48f84ad20968f2d8823a6b24756769c0ddf:0

value
7105091
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 87dc496d6d84ebb7857d4f6970ea0b5f263ed99a OP_EQUALVERIFY OP_CHECKSIG
address
1DPN7hFyB8cgh7MZNMutXHGL9DKXaabWWa
transaction
efa3181a94ed4421dea3e46cabd4e48f84ad20968f2d8823a6b24756769c0ddf
spent
true